Understanding Resolution Options
When it comes to body cameras, resolutions typically range from standard definition (SD) to high definition (HD) and even ultra-high definition (UHD). Here’s a breakdown of common resolution types:
- Standard Definition (480p): Suitable for basic recordings; however, details can be lost in low-light conditions.
- High Definition (720p/1080p): Offers significantly better clarity and detail; ideal for general use where quality is important.
- Ultra High Definition (4K): Provides exceptional detail and is perfect for professional settings requiring meticulous documentation.

Evaluating Storage Capacity
Storage capacity is another critical factor when choosing a body camera, directly affecting how much footage we can store before needing to offload data or delete older files. Here are some key points to consider regarding storage:
- Internal vs. External Storage: Some cameras come with built-in memory, while others allow for external SD cards, providing flexibility based on our needs.
- File Compression Options: Many modern cameras use compression technology which enables longer recordings without sacrificing quality significantly.
- Recording Time Estimates: Understanding how different settings impact file sizes helps us estimate recording times accurately.
| Resolution | Estimated Recording Time per 32GB |
|---|---|
| 480p | Up to 12 hours |
| 720p | Up to 8 hours |
| 1080p | Up to 4 hours |
| 4K | Up to 2 hours |

Understanding Durability Standards
The durability of a body camera often hinges on its construction materials and design specifications. We should look for models that meet or exceed certain standards:
- Impact Resistance: Cameras designed with shock-absorbing materials help prevent damage from accidental falls.
- Ingress Protection (IP) Ratings: An IP rating indicates the level of protection against solids and liquids; higher ratings mean better resistance to dust and moisture.
- Temperature Tolerance: Understanding how well a camera performs under varying temperatures ensures functionality in diverse environments.
Evaluating Weather Resistance Features
A body camera’s ability to resist weather-related challenges is another critical consideration. When assessing this feature, we should take into account:
- Waterproofing: Look for cameras specifically labeled as waterproof or water-resistant to protect against rain or accidental splashes.
- Dust Sealing: Cameras that are sealed against dust intrusion ensure reliable operation in sandy or dirty environments.
- Corrosion Resistance: Materials used in construction should ideally resist corrosion from exposure to harsh elements over time.
| Feature Type | Description/Rating Example |
|---|---|
| Impact Resistance | MIL-STD-810G compliant (withstands 6-foot drops) |
| IP Rating (Ingress Protection) | IP67 (dust-tight and protected against immersion up to 1 meter) |
| Temperature Range | -20°C to 60°C (-4°F to 140°F) |
| Waterproof Level | Splashproof vs Waterproof (submersion capabilities) |

Wireless Connectivity Features
A body camera equipped with robust wireless connectivity options enhances our flexibility in transferring data quickly and easily. Key wireless features to consider include:
- Wi-Fi: This enables rapid file transfers directly to cloud storage or compatible devices without needing physical connections.
- Bluetooth: Useful for connecting accessories such as microphones or remote controls, Bluetooth can simplify how we operate the device during recording.
- Mobile App Integration: Some cameras offer companion apps that allow for remote viewing and management of recordings from smartphones or tablets.
Data Transfer Options
The methods by which data is transferred from the body camera are equally important. We should look for models that provide various options:
- USB Ports: A standard USB interface allows us to connect directly to computers for quick uploads.
- SD Card Compatibility: Many cameras support external memory cards, making it easier to transfer large amounts of footage without relying solely on internal storage capacity.
- HDMI Output: For immediate playback on larger screens, HDMI ports facilitate direct connections to monitors or televisions.
| Connectivity Type | Description/Benefit |
|---|---|
| Wi-Fi | Facilitates fast data uploads and cloud integration. |
| Bluetooth | Allows pairing with accessories like microphones. |
| USB Ports | Eases direct connection for file transfers. |
| SD Card Support | Makes managing large video files simpler. |
